THE big question on the lips of most West Ham fans at the moment is, “Will Avram Grant survive the chop in the coming months?”
The Carling Cup result against Man United, and the must-win match at home to Wigan, helped to restore a fair bit of faith, but there are still rumblings in the stands that Grant is not the man to take the Hammers forward.
We feel it’s in the balance and we make it an even money chance that he won’t be in the hot seat on May 22nd 2011.
Grant is 8/11 to survive. The real damning evidence that puts Grant in trouble though is the fact that he is 4/5 to be the next Premier League manager to leave his post.

The Hammers travel to Sunderland on Sunday and they are 7/2 to make it three victories in a row.
It’ll be a tough ask, and the busy December fixture list will go a long way towards deciding his fate. There are 18 points up for grabs, but we feel they’ll get a lot less.
